Desenvolvedor Fullstack .NET / React - Pleno
A FCamara está em busca de um(a) Desenvolvedora Fullstack .NET / React - Pleno, para atuar em parceria com o maior Banco de Investimentos da América Latina, especializado em capital de investimento, de risco, além de gerenciamento de patrimônio e ativos globais.Responsabilidades e atribuiçõesResponsabilidades e atribuições: Desenvolver projetos com foco em performance e escalabilidade;· Automatizar processos com o objetivo de garantir a alta disponibilidade dos sistemas;· Entregar códigos (utilizando as boas práticas do SOLID, Clean Code, Orientação a Objetos e Padrões de Projetos) em um ambiente Cloud AWS, seja Container ou Serverless;Requisitos e qualificaçõesHard Skills:· Ter sólida experiência com a Plataforma >= .NET 10 - Linguagem C#;· Ter experiência em desenvolvimento de sistemas legados Windows Applications;· Ter experiência em desenvolvimento com a tecnologia WCF e serviços WS;· Ter experiência em desenvolvimento de FrontEnd - Linguagem React;· Ter conhecimentos em serviços Cloud (Preferência: AWS);· Ter experiência em Programação Orientada a Objetos;· Ter experiência em aplicações orquestradas em Microsserviços;· Ter sólida experiência em APIs Restfull;· Ter experiência em Mensageria (Preferências: AWS Cloud e RabbitMQ);· Ter experiência com metodologias ágeis de Desenvolvimento de Software (Exemplo: Scrum);· Ter habilidade analítica para identificar problemas e propor soluções;· Ter capacidade de trabalhar em equipe e comunicar-se de forma clara e objetiva;· Ter habilidade de organização e gestão de tempo para cumprimento dos prazos estipulados;Habilidades diferenciais:· Ter experiência com Test Driven Development;· Ter conhecimento em DATADOG;· Ter conhecimento do Azure Devops;· Ter conhecimentos de Clean Code;· Ter conhecimentos de Domain Driven Design;· Ter conhecimentos dos princípios do SOLID;· Ter conhecimento do Github e estratégia de ramificação do ciclo de desenvolvimento (Exemplo: Git Flow ou GitHub Flow);· Ter conhecimentos gerais de mercado financeiro;· Ter a capacidade de aprendizado contínuo;· Ter conhecimento em IA (Copilot / Cursor / Outros);Soft Skills:Boa comunicação Raciocínio lógico e capacidade analítica;Autonomia, resolução de problemas. Espírito de equipe e capacidade de resolução de conflitos;Criatividade e Proatividade para imaginar diferentes cenários de uso das aplicações;Organização e Protagonismo. Atua de forma efetiva para cumprir prazos.Informações adicionais